# KeySpinner client setup
# KeySpinner is Fernwick Labs' internal secrets-rotation utility. It rotates
# credentials for downstream services every 14 days and pushes the new values
# to the Vaultlet cache. New contractors: do not rotate manually; the scheduler
# handles it. The client below authenticates against the rotation API using
# the key that follows on the next line.

service key, fawip-bajef: kto11_Qt5wZK9vdNC

Slimming pass for the Corvane API images: base switched to the minimal Ostlin runtime, shells and package managers stripped, build tooling moved to a separate stage. Verify no secrets baked into layers. Run the layer-diff scan and confirm the final image carries only the binary, certs, and config. Flag anything with setuid bits. Approved images get re-signed by the Harrowgate pipeline. Reference the build token recorded directly below this line.

pipeline stamp: htk3_317

Subject: Insurance Renewal — Action Required

All,

Our combined liability and property cover with Merrowfield Assurance renews on the first of next month. Premiums rise 8% following last year's warehouse claim at Dunholt. We have accepted the renewal terms but increased the excess to contain costs. Heads of department must confirm their asset registers are current by Thursday. Implications for next year's budget are summarised in the confidential note below.

Thanks,
V. Arnesque

internal memo for fawef-tajeg: Headcount on the Wenvan team goes from 33 to 121 by the end of January. Gross margin on Wenvan came in at 47 percent against a plan of 51 percent.